本文探讨了区块链技术在供应链管理中的应用,包括增强透明度和效率、具体案例(如沃尔玛的食品溯源、马士基的TradeLens平台)以及面临的挑战(如集成复杂性、可扩展性限制、监管问题)。区块链通过提供不可篡改的记录、自动化流程和促进协作,有望彻底改变供应链的运作方式,但同时也需要解决技术和监管方面的障碍。
什么空投合约“空投合约”(AirdropContract)是指专门用于自动向一组地址发送代币或NFT的智能合约:https://learnblockchain.cn/shawn_shaw
本篇作为“以太坊工作原理”专题的第一篇,从区块链的结构和核心特性出发,讲解区块、链式结构、数据不可篡改原理、与传统数据库的区别,并阐述区块链作为“信任机器”的技术本质,为后续深入以太坊打下概念基础。
上一篇文章我们使用Rust编程语言创建一个猜数字游戏,仅仅只能打印出来用户的输入,我们这一小节会引入更多的功能。首先,我们希望系统给我们生成一个随机数,我们也输入一个数字,然后和系统生成的随机数来进行比较.
该文章提议用RISC-V取代EVM作为智能合约的虚拟机语言,旨在提高以太坊执行层的效率和简化性。此举将优化ZK-EVM的性能,并可能带来超过100倍的效率提升。文章还讨论了多种实现方案,包括支持双虚拟机、将现有EVM合约转换为调用RISC-V编写的EVM解释器合约等。
本文讨论了Safe智能合约架构中,是否应该使用Diamond Proxy模式。
Web3实践:在Polkadot上用Solidity玩转DelegatecallWeb3浪潮席卷而来,智能合约作为区块链世界的核心驱动力,正变得越来越灵活和强大。在Polkadot这个多链生态中,Solidity依然是开发者的得力工具,而delegatecall则像是合约设
本文介绍了 Foundry 中的不变性测试(Invariant Testing),它是一种强大的模糊测试方法,通过定义必须始终成立的规则,让 Foundry 尝试通过随机调用序列来打破合约,从而发现潜在的错误。文章解释了不变性测试的原理、关键参数、测试结构、常见模式和一些注意事项,并提供了一个实际的例子。
文章详细介绍了Solana区块链中的Sealevel技术,即并行处理数千个智能合约的运行时环境,并解释了Solana如何通过并行处理实现高性能。
本文是Advanced Foundry Cheatcodes系列文章的第六部分,介绍了 Foundry 的高级模糊测试功能,通过随机输入参数自动发现智能合约的边缘情况,包括溢出、回滚等问题。文章还涉及了如何使用 forking cheat-codes 与主网合约交互,以及如何通过 vm.assume 和 bound() 来缩小输入范围,从而提高测试效率。
本文介绍了如何通过 Alchemy 提供的 Sepolia Faucet 快速获取免费的 Sepolia ETH 测试币,用于在 Sepolia 测试网上测试以太坊智能合约。文章详细说明了访问 faucet 网站、创建 Alchemy 账户以及请求 SepoliaETH 的步骤。
该文章介绍了农业领域中现实世界资产(RWA)代币化的概念,它指的是将农业商品(如农田、作物、牲畜等)的所有权或部分所有权表示为区块链网络上的数字代币的过程。文章讨论了代币化农业资产的潜在优势,包括提高流动性、增强透明度、提高市场效率和投资民主化,以及代币化农业商品的关键用例和应用,例如抵押贷款、DeFi平台的结合等。
2025年1月23日,新加坡加密货币交易所Phemex遭遇重大安全漏洞,导致约3700万美元的数字资产被未授权提取。攻击者利用多条区块链网络的智能合约漏洞,实施超过125笔可疑交易,突显了中心化交易所的安全协议缺陷。
Beanstalk是一个基于以太坊的无权限稳定币协议,旨在通过其原生稳定币Bean创建一个租金免费的经济体系。文章还分析了漏洞的具体原因并阐述了修复措施,包括移除了弱点函数和引入了安全的新函数。
该视频深入探讨了以太坊的Trace API和Debug API之间的关键区别,分析了它们各自的功能,并为开发者推荐了最佳选择,以便高效调试智能合约。